PK exhorts people to oust Nitish Kumar government from power

PK exhorts people to oust Nitish Kumar government from power

Patna, June 02 (UNI) Founder of " Jan Suraaj " Prashant Kishor on Monday exhorted the people to oust the Nitish Kumar government from power in the next Bihar assembly elections to be held in October-November this year.
Kishor popularly known as PK while addressing a public meeting during his " Badlao Yatra " in East Champaran district of Bihar, said that it was high time for people of Bihar to oust the Nitish Kumar government from power in the next state assembly elections to be held in October-November this year. The Nitish Kumar government had failed in creating employment opportunities for youths of Bihar, as no factory was established in the state during the last twenty years, he added.
" People should not extend their support to Chief Minister Nitish Kumar even after an appeal made by Prime Minister Narendra Modi to them ", PK said, adding that Modi was not at all interested in the development of Bihar. Factories were being established in Gujarat while youths of Bihar were going there to work as labourers, as there were no job opportunities for them in their home state, he further added.
